About us:

St Vincent’s Hospital Sydney is a world leading heart and lung hospital with an internationally recognised transplantation program.  The hospital is a distinguished non-profit organisation, providing personalised care to patients who travel from across Australia and overseas for treatment.  St Vincent’s is at the forefront of healthcare, research and innovation. 

The Heart Lung Clinical Stream includes acute inpatient wards, advanced cardiac imaging and non-admitted patient care, with specialist expertise in complex cardiothoracic surgery, sleep disorders and pulmonary hypertension.  Guided by our values of compassion, excellence, integrity and justice, St Vincent’s promotes a culture of diversity and inclusion, enabling staff to learn, grow, innovate and achieve.

About the role:

Passion and compassion are valued at St Vincent’s.  You can make a difference somewhere special.  If you are a nurse, we would love to hear from you. While experience in cardiac or critical care nursing is appreciated, it is not a prerequisite.  We provide training and education to ensure that you can develop and enhance your skillset.

Vacancies exist in the Cardiothoracic and Respiratory Unit (Xavier 10 South) for highly motivated Registered Nurses to join our friendly and supportive team.  The ward consists of a 6-bed High Dependency Unit and 22-bed cardiothoracic, transplant and respiratory ward.  Staff are encouraged to participate in staff professional development opportunities as well as our cardiothoracic and heart lung transplant and interventional cardiology post graduate courses.
